It’s time for an International Game Week (IGW) Sponsor Spotlight! This time, it’s Dream On, a cooperative storytelling game from CMON! Dream On is a game about memory and dreams. You’ll work together with your team of 2-8 players to build dreams using dream cards. Using your hand of dream cards to contribute to the dream, you will try to tie together disparate images and themes to make a cohesive dream. But be quick! You only have two minutes for the dreaming phase.
Then your team will move on to the remembering phase. The last player to contribute to the dream picks up the dream card pile face down and tries to recall the dream. As they recall the dream, they flip over the cards to reveal if they correctly remembered the dream or not. Since this is a cooperative game, their team can help with recalling the dream!
Scoring points is set up in a unique way in this game – with points going toward (or being subtracted from) the team as a whole. If the individual recalling the dream remembers a sequence correctly, the team gets two points! If they get a part of the dream correct with help from the team, the team gets one point. But if they get part of the dream wrong (individually or collectively) the team loses two points! You score the dream based on the number of points you have at the end of the remembering phase, aiming for 61 points or more to have the ultimate dream!
Dream On can be played quickly with a play time of 15-20 minutes. The game has a whimsical art style, with dream cards displaying images of wildlife, people, objects, and places (including outer space). Because the dream you create is different every time you play, Dream On has a lot of replayability. This game is also great for building improvisation or storytelling skills.
